September 16, 2013 -- The Michigan Department of Transportation (MDOT) has launched an online survey to learn what Michigan commercial truck drivers think of the performance of the state highway system (I, M and US routes), and better understand their needs and opinions. The survey can be found online at Commercial Truck Driver Survey.
MDOT has been surveying the attitudes and perceptions of residents, visitors, businesses and transportation partners since 2005 to learn what it is doing right and what it can do better in proving transportation services. This year, MDOT is gathering information from commercial shippers, starting with the trucking industry.
"These survey results will help us track our progress in improving service to our customers," said State Transportation Director Kirk T. Steudle. "As always, MDOT is committed to making travel in Michigan safer and more efficient."
The survey is available online until Wednesday, Sept. 25.
